NUXE’s new hair care routine begins with the pre-shampoo mask, which is enriched with fermented pink camellia oil, castor and jojoba oil. It provides an exceptionally nourishing protective film and is applied to dry hair before shampooing. This means the oil is better absorbed and has an intensive repairing effect. Leave on for 10-30 minutes and rinse gently.

The heart of the Hair Prodigieux® care ritual is the plant-based and sulfate-free shine shampoo, which gently cleanses the hair and removes impurities. The milky texture transforms into a sensual foam and leaves the hair feeling silky-soft. The fermented pink camellia oil provides an extra dose of shine.

The silicone-free shine conditioner repairs damaged hair with panthenol (provitamin B5) and fermented camellia oil. Apply a small amount to damp, towel-dried hair and work into the lengths and ends. Rinse thoroughly after about a minute. The conditioner detangles and strengthens the hair and creates an irresistible shine.

The intensively nourishing leave-in cream provides the hair with extra moisture with fermented camellia oil and quinoa extract and completes the Hair Prodigieux® routine. After washing your hair, apply a small drop to the lengths of your hair – give tips. The Leave-In Cream not only ensures supple hair, but also protects it when styling with hot devices up to 220°C thanks to its integrated heat protection effect.
